The Tecno Pop 5 and Xiaomi Redmi 9A Sport represent the extreme end of the smartphone price spectrum. Both aim to deliver basic smartphone functionality at an incredibly low cost, but they take different approaches. The Pop 5 prioritizes affordability above all else, while the Redmi 9A Sport attempts to offer a more balanced experience with a more powerful chipset.
🏆 Quick Verdict
For the average user, the Xiaomi Redmi 9A Sport is the clear winner. Its Mediatek Helio G25 chipset, with its octa-core CPU, provides a significantly smoother and more responsive experience than the Tecno Pop 5’s quad-core Cortex-A7. While both phones are limited, the Redmi 9A Sport offers a better chance of handling everyday tasks and even light gaming.

Performance
This is where the Redmi 9A Sport truly shines. Its Mediatek Helio G25 chipset, built on a 12nm process, features an octa-core CPU configuration (4x2.0 GHz Cortex-A53 & 4x1.5 GHz Cortex-A53). This is a substantial upgrade over the Tecno Pop 5’s quad-core 1.3 GHz Cortex-A7. The Helio G25’s architecture allows for better multitasking and faster app loading times. The Cortex-A53 cores, while not the latest, are significantly more capable than the older Cortex-A7 found in the Pop 5. The 12nm process also contributes to improved power efficiency compared to older node technologies.

Buying Guide
Buy the Tecno Pop 5 if you absolutely need the cheapest possible smartphone for basic communication – calls, texts, and very light app usage. It’s a viable option for first-time smartphone users or as a temporary device. Buy the Xiaomi Redmi 9A Sport if you prioritize a more usable experience, even on a tight budget. The improved processor makes a noticeable difference in app loading times, multitasking, and overall responsiveness, making it suitable for users who want a bit more from their phone.
